WWE Not Expecting Fans Back Until Second Half Of 2021

WWE Not Expecting Fans Back Until Second Half Of 2021

Despite fans being allowed in attendance for both nights of WrestleMania 37, it will be a while still before fans are permitted at live events consistently.

During the WWE’s first-quarter earnings call today it was said that the company does not anticipate a return for fans until the second half of 2021. This was quoted and reported by Sean Ross Sapp of Fightful.

It does need to be mentioned that with May less than ten days away, the second half of 2021 is right around the corner. Technically speaking, July would mark the start of the second half of the year. That doesn’t mean July is when fans may return but it can serve as the earliest date possible.

Besides WrestleMania, the last time WWE allowed a paying crowd for a main roster show was the March 9, 2020 edition of Raw.
